A grease designed for lubrication of aircraft components such as actuators, engine accessories, control bearings, landing gears, and wheel bearings. It does not include grease, aircraft and instrument and grease, instrument.

Routes of entry: inhalation: no skin: no ingestion: no
reports of carcinogenicity: ntp: no iarc: no osha: no
health hazards acute and chronic: target organs: skin. Acute- none.
prolonged/repeated skin contact may cause mild irritation in some
individuals. Chronic- none.
explanation of carcinogenicity: none
effects of overexposure: mild skin irritation
medical cond aggravated by exposure: none
First aid: get medical help if symptoms persist. Inhaled: move to fresh
air. Eyes: flush with plenty of water. Skin: wipe off and wash with
soap & water. Oral: seek medical attention.
Hcc: v6
nrc/state lic num: not relevant
boiling pt: b.P. Text: >500f,>260c
decomp temp: decomp text: >550f,>288c
vapor pres:
spec gravity: 1.05
solubility in water: negligible
appearance and odor: light tan grease - petroleum odor
Stability indicator/materials to avoid: yes
strong oxidizing agents
stability condition to avoid: temperatures above 250f
hazardous decomposition products: fluorine products, silicon dioxide,
carbon monoxide, carbon dioxide
Waste disposal methods: incinerate or recycle. Disposal must be in
accordance with local, state and federal regulations.
